Calliope

  • Origin
    Greek
  • Meaning
    The name Calliope is often interpreted to mean "beautiful voice" or "beautiful speech" in Greek. It represents the essence of artistic expression and the power of eloquent communication.
  • Variations
    Kalliope, Caliope, Kalliopeia
  • Similar names
    Clio, Calista, Penelope, Ariadne, Melody

  • The name Calliope carries a timeless allure, originating from the rich tapestry of Greek mythology. As the Muse of epic poetry and eloquence, Calliope symbolizes the artistry of language and the captivating power of a beautiful voice.
